The Japan Intralogistics Software Market size was valued at USD 133.2 million in 2024, and is projected to grow to USD 171.1 million by 2025. Additionally, the industry is expected to continue its growth trajectory, reaching USD 502.6 million by 2030, at a CAGR of 24.05% from 2025 to 2030.

Japan’s strong industrial and manufacturing sectors are a key driver of the intralogistics software market. Industries such as automotive, electronics, robotics, and consumer goods are increasingly adopting AI-powered warehouse management systems, automated guided vehicles (AGVs), and robotics to optimize internal logistics and improve operational efficiency. Japan’s focus on Industry 4.0, smart manufacturing, and technological innovation encourages companies to implement advanced intralogistics solutions, enhancing productivity, reducing operational costs, and improving supply chain responsiveness. This emphasis on automation and innovation is fuelling the Japan intralogistics software market expansion.
The rapid growth of e-commerce in Japan is significantly boosting demand for intralogistics software solutions. Rising consumer expectations for fast, accurate, and reliable deliveries are prompting retailers and logistics providers to implement automated warehouse systems, real-time inventory management, and AI-driven order fulfillment tools. Key logistics hubs such as Tokyo, Osaka, and Nagoya are witnessing increasing adoption of intralogistics solutions to streamline operations, improve order accuracy, and enhance overall supply chain efficiency. The combination of e-commerce expansion and modernization of logistics infrastructure is creating strong growth opportunities across Japan.
Despite strong growth drivers, the high cost of implementation and the shortage of skilled personnel restrain the intralogistics software market in Japan. Deploying advanced automation technologies, robotics, and AI-powered warehouse management systems requires substantial capital investment, which be challenging for small and medium-sized enterprises. Additionally, the limited availability of skilled professionals capable of managing and integrating complex intralogistics solutions slows adoption. These financial and workforce constraints limit the market’s full potential, restraining growth despite high demand for efficiency and technological advancement.
